Understanding Slip and Fall Accidents
A slip and fall accident occurs when an individual slips, trips, or falls due to hazardous conditions on someone else's property. These accidents can happen in various settings, including:
- Retail Stores: Wet floors, uneven pavement, or cluttered aisles can lead to slip and fall accidents in grocery stores and retail shops.
- Restaurants: Spills, low lighting, or poorly maintained stairs are common causes of such accidents in dining establishments.
- Public Spaces: Parks, sidewalks, and parking lots can have potholes or icy surfaces that pose risks to pedestrians.
- Private Residences: Homeowners can be held liable if their property contains hazards that lead to injuries for visitors.
Evidencing Negligence
To establish liability in a slip and fall case, plaintiffs must demonstrate that the property owner was negligent. This involves proving several elements:
- Duty of Care: The property owner had a legal obligation to ensure the safety of visitors on their premises.
- Breaching the Duty: The owner failed to fix or warn about a hazardous condition that they knew or should have known about.
- Causation: The unsafe condition directly caused the slip and fall accident.
- Damages: The victim suffered real harm as a result of the fall, such as medical expenses, lost wages, or pain and suffering.

Common Injuries Associated with Slip and Fall Accidents
Victims of slip and fall incidents may suffer various injuries that can drastically affect their quality of life. Common injuries include:
- Fractures: Commonly affecting the wrist, ankle, or hip, fractures may require surgery and extensive rehabilitation.
- Head Injuries: Traumatic brain injuries can result from falls, leading to long-term cognitive impairments.
- Soft Tissue Injuries: Sprains and strains may cause chronic pain and limit mobility.
- Spinal Cord Injuries: Falls can lead to severe damage to the spinal cord, resulting in paralysis or long-term disability.

Statistics on Slip and Fall Cases
Understanding the prevalence of slip and fall accidents can help underscore their significance in personal injury law:
- According to the National Floor Safety Institute, slip and fall accidents account for over 1 million emergency room visits annually.
- Slip and fall incidents contribute to more than 20,000 deaths each year.
- They are the leading cause of worker’s compensation claims and can lead to long-term disability.
